// rtcConnection is a WebRTC connection proxy, for both WHIP and WHEP. It represents a WebRTC
// connection, identify by the ufrag in sdp offer/answer and ICE binding request.
//
// It's not like RTMP or HTTP FLV/TS proxy connection, which are stateless and all state is
// in the client request. The rtcConnection is stateful, and need to sync the ufrag between
// proxy servers.
//
// The media transport is UDP, which is also a special thing for WebRTC. So if the client switch
// to another UDP address, it may connect to another WebRTC proxy, then we should discover the
// rtcConnection by the ufrag from the ICE binding request.
type rtcConnection struct {
// The stream context for WebRTC streaming.
ctx context.Context
// The stream URL in vhost/app/stream schema.
StreamURL string `json:"stream_url"`
// The ufrag for this WebRTC connection.
Ufrag string `json:"ufrag"`
// The UDP connection proxy to backend.
backendUDP *net.UDPConn
// The client UDP address. Note that it may change.
clientUDP *net.UDPAddr
// The listener UDP connection, used to send messages to client.
listenerUDP *net.UDPConn
}

type rtcStunPacket struct {
// The stun message type.
MessageType uint16
// The stun username, or ufrag.
Username string
}
func (v *rtcStunPacket) UnmarshalBinary(data []byte) error {
if len(data) < 20 {
return errors.Errorf("stun packet too short %v", len(data))
}
p := data
v.MessageType = binary.BigEndian.Uint16(p)
messageLen := binary.BigEndian.Uint16(p[2:])
//magicCookie := p[:8]
//transactionID := p[:20]
p = p[20:]
if len(p) != int(messageLen) {
return errors.Errorf("stun packet length invalid %v != %v", len(data), messageLen)
}
for len(p) > 0 {
typ := binary.BigEndian.Uint16(p)
length := binary.BigEndian.Uint16(p[2:])
p = p[4:]
if len(p) < int(length) {
return errors.Errorf("stun attribute length invalid %v < %v", len(p), length)
}
value := p[:length]
p = p[length:]
if length%4 != 0 {
p = p[4-length%4:]
}
switch typ {
case 0x0006:
v.Username = string(value)
}
}
return nil
}
